ducana
Meanings
noun
- An Antiguan dish made using sweet potatoes, white flour, sugar, vanilla essence, grated coconut and sometime raisins, blended and wrapped in large grape leaves or aluminum foil and boiled, often served with salted fish in tomato sauce.
